Transaction 897107409295fc68726999985c2d43d6eee4d17a18a6c70e87f3de11602a1f28

1 Input
2 Outputs
  • 897107409295fc68726999985c2d43d6eee4d17a18a6c70e87f3de11602a1f28:0
  • value  13758
    address  31vHCnwDFHnzrDzUiTgvakAkfTNyDjnwwz
  • 897107409295fc68726999985c2d43d6eee4d17a18a6c70e87f3de11602a1f28:1
  • value  12651915
    address  3QE2jX4UDgvA374jn3zCDXTM6NS21nT4So